A consent log is a stored, timestamped record of each visitor’s consent choice, used as proof for a regulator or an audit.
Under GDPR Article 7(1), you must be able to demonstrate that a visitor gave consent. A consent log helps you meet that requirement; it does not guarantee compliance on its own.
